Nikon 7510 Travelite 10 X 25 mm V Binoculars

March 7, 2010 by  
Filed under Products

  • Compact rubber-coated design for easy grip
  • Multicoated optics
  • BaK4 high-index prisms
  • Clicking diopter control for strain-free viewing
  • Quick central focusing

Product Description
The new Travelite V series binoculars incorporate several new features designed to make them more user friendly while enhancing optical performance.Nikon Travelite V binoculars utilize precision ground, multicoated optics, and high index BaK4 prisms for true color rendition, maximum sharpness and enhanced light transmission. The new binoculars use aspherical eyepiece lenses which provide a very flat viewing field and offer markedly improved edge-to-edge sharpness ov... More >>

Missouri Bird Watching: A Year-Round Guide

March 7, 2010 by  
Filed under Products

Product Description
There are no state-specific books on how to appreciate birds and learn more about them. Like gardening, Bird Watching is a regional hobby, and the birds that frequent the backyards of Missouri differ from the birds found in Michigan. This series targets beginning and intermediate bird watchers from each Midwestern state. The books are state-specific and highlight the birds that are found in each state. Birds, Birds, Birds! An Indoor Birdwatching Field Trip DVD Video Bird and Bird Song Guide

March 7, 2010 by  
Filed under Products

Description
The DVD can be viewed on the living room TV or on personal computers as a 70-minute bird-filled documentary. It also serves as an audio/visual reference guide-- one can use the easy-to-use menus to quickly find a particular bird (it contains 218 species found in Midwest and Eastern North America).
